Family: Rosaceae

Scientific Name: Prunus glandosa

Common Name: Dwarf Flowering Plum

DescriptionA medium shrub that produces a plethora of flowers in the spring.
Pronunciation(PRUU-nus)(glan-duu-LO-sa)
Plant TypeAll Plants, Shrubs Deciduous
Hardiness Zone4
Sunlightfull
Moistureaverage
Soil & Siteaverage
Flowerspink, white, white with pink, early spring, single or double
Fruitsubglobose dark red fruits
Leavesgreen, lacking fall foliage color
Dimensions4-5 by 3-4 feet
Maintenancesuckers, will naturalize
Propagationseeds, cuttings
Native Sitenorthern and central China, Japan
Cultivar Originintroduced in 1835
